Challenges beyond Measure...

On a planet divided by faith in the Gods and devotion to the Elemental Lords, all must pick sides. In these pages are a multitude of creatures both fell and benign for use by Game Masters—and players, too—for the Lands of Porphyra Campaign Setting. With Monsters of Porphyra 2 you will be able to hunt the skywhales of the Reversed Lands, hold back the incursion of the Oncoming Wave by destroying its servant the Rotwood, summon amalgessi proteans from the realms of the Slithering Symphony, and gain the favor of powerful Lung Dragons. All monsters are complete with statistics to play, background, and a depiction of the creature, be it ally or enemy.

Purple Duck Games brings you its second full-length bestiary of converted gamer favorites and intriguing new selections, in the OGL tradition that considers fans and supporters first. This tome also is another great leap in the support of Purple Duck’s Lands of Porphyra Campaign Setting. Take a glance at the fractured cosmos populated by beasts and beings wondrous and strange...

Monsters of Porphyra includes:

- More than 120 different monsters including many new monsters.
- More than 6 reimagined monster templates.
- Foes from across all challenge ratings, environments, and monster types.
- New animal companions and monster cohorts.
- Notes for each monster for use with the Lands of Porphyra Campaign Setting!
- And so much more...

So Mark, what would you say your favorite monster in this book is, and why?


That is really hard for me to answer. I worked on most of the monsters in the book so I'm quite attached to most of them.

The squiggler golem is a particular favorite. I originally used this creature in a d20 adventure that was part of the Dungeon Dive series by Amalara Press Original Book.

It is a nice low-level construct that can merge with walls and pretend to be a drawing or it can leap free gouge as enemies with its claws.

The art for it is by Brett Neufeld out of Winnipeg. He is a new artist that recently started working for us.
